Transaction 14505c52f5b526f300abc78682833dcdf2617a0e6b5e39a4d10f1ac3c79da4e6
1 Input
1 Output
-
14505c52f5b526f300abc78682833dcdf2617a0e6b5e39a4d10f1ac3c79da4e6:0
- value
- 11295981
- script pubkey
- OP_0 OP_PUSHBYTES_20 aceb32de0c975202e574e1db8157a052ef1907d9
- address
- bc1q4n4n9hsvjafq9et5u8dcz4aq2th3jp7eyv0r0p